2mm neodymium magnets have a magnetic field approximately 11 times stronger than conventional magnets and are used in a variety of industries, including automotive, aerospace, manufacturing, and electronics. They are used in Magnetic sensors, MRI machines, and even headphones and speakers. One of the main advantages of neodymium magnets is their compact, lightweight design, which allows them to deliver powerful magnetic fields in a small size. This makes them ideal for electronic devices and products where size and weight are important factors.

9.About 2mm neodymium magnets raw materials

Neodymium magnets are made from an alloy of neodymium, iron, and boron. This alloy is known as NIB or NdFeB. The neodymium is the main component of the alloy, and it is what gives the magnets their strong magnetic properties. The iron and boron are added to the alloy to increase its strength and durability. Neodymium magnets are the strongest type of permanent magnet available, and they are used in a wide variety of applications.
